WebPhlegm and mucus are technically one and the same: Phlegm is mucus that is created in your respiratory system, especially your chest, while fighting an infection—a byproduct of … Web1. Sinusitis. White phlegm can be produced with sinusitis, which is an inflammation that affects that sinus cavities in the nose, eyes and cheeks areas. This condition can last for 4 to 12 weeks. In addition to white phlegm, you may also experience fever, pressure within the ears, fatigue, runny nose and bad breath.

Small amounts of white mucus may be coughed up if the bronchitis is viral. If the color of the mucus changes to green or yellow, it may be a sign that a bacterial infection has also set in. The cough is usually the last symptom to clear up and may last for weeks.
